Transaction 82405c3ad3684c76448e0eb295ff0c93a93a4faa329d9f6ea9a255aabdba89a7

1 Input
2 Outputs
  • 82405c3ad3684c76448e0eb295ff0c93a93a4faa329d9f6ea9a255aabdba89a7:0
  • value  3855670
    address  3Pdd43LaDcPpEGMZtJgPPGxr5cuwQRbFVy
  • 82405c3ad3684c76448e0eb295ff0c93a93a4faa329d9f6ea9a255aabdba89a7:1
  • value  303047311
    address  1FwFF7Ukd2K2SsC5UBNq2H61uutHc76dLS